Axinn partner Mark Alexander authored an article entitled, "United States: Mergers," for GCR's The Antitrust Review of the Americas 2019.
The article provides an update on United States merger activity over the past year, focusing on the following:
- The landmark AT&T/Time Warner case: vertical enforcement strikes out
- A smoother past for horizontal mergers?
- Health Care enforcement: a continuing agency priority
- Consumer goods: the power of the brand?
- Minority interests draw antitrust interest
